黑狐家游戏

分布式文件系统架构,揭秘其核心组成与工作原理

欧气 0 0

本文目录导读:

  1. 分布式文件系统概述
  2. 分布式文件系统架构
  3. 分布式文件系统工作原理

随着互联网的快速发展,大数据时代的到来,分布式文件系统在数据存储、处理和传输方面发挥着越来越重要的作用,本文将从分布式文件系统的基本架构入手,深入剖析其核心组成与工作原理,为读者提供一个全面而深入的解析。

分布式文件系统概述

分布式文件系统(Distributed File System,DFS)是一种将文件存储在多个物理节点上的文件系统,与传统的集中式文件系统相比,分布式文件系统具有更高的可靠性和可扩展性,其主要特点如下:

分布式文件系统架构,揭秘其核心组成与工作原理

图片来源于网络,如有侵权联系删除

1、可靠性:分布式文件系统通过冗余存储和故障转移机制,确保数据不会因为单个节点的故障而丢失。

2、可扩展性:分布式文件系统可以轻松地添加或删除节点,以适应不断增长的数据需求。

3、高性能:分布式文件系统通过并行处理和负载均衡,提高数据访问速度。

4、易用性:分布式文件系统提供统一的接口,方便用户进行数据存储、访问和管理。

分布式文件系统架构

分布式文件系统架构主要包括以下几个部分:

1、数据存储节点:负责存储文件数据,通常由多个物理节点组成。

分布式文件系统架构,揭秘其核心组成与工作原理

图片来源于网络,如有侵权联系删除

2、元数据服务器:负责存储和管理文件的元数据,如文件名、文件大小、权限等信息。

3、负载均衡器:负责将客户端请求分发到不同的数据存储节点,以提高数据访问速度。

4、网络通信模块:负责数据存储节点之间的通信,包括数据传输、心跳检测等。

5、故障检测与恢复机制:负责检测节点故障,并进行相应的故障恢复操作。

6、安全机制:负责保障数据传输和存储的安全性,如数据加密、访问控制等。

分布式文件系统工作原理

1、文件存储:用户将文件上传到分布式文件系统时,系统会将文件分割成多个数据块,并存储到不同的数据存储节点上,为了提高可靠性,系统会采用冗余存储策略,如数据副本。

分布式文件系统架构,揭秘其核心组成与工作原理

图片来源于网络,如有侵权联系删除

2、元数据管理:元数据服务器负责存储和管理文件的元数据,当用户请求访问文件时,系统会根据文件名或文件ID等信息,在元数据服务器中查找对应的文件信息,并将请求转发到相应的数据存储节点。

3、负载均衡:负载均衡器根据数据存储节点的负载情况,将客户端请求分发到不同的节点,以实现负载均衡。

4、故障检测与恢复:系统通过心跳检测机制,实时监控数据存储节点的状态,当检测到节点故障时,系统会将其从数据存储节点列表中移除,并进行相应的故障恢复操作。

5、安全机制:分布式文件系统采用多种安全机制,如数据加密、访问控制等,以保障数据传输和存储的安全性。

分布式文件系统架构在数据存储、处理和传输方面具有诸多优势,通过对分布式文件系统核心组成与工作原理的深入剖析,我们能够更好地理解其工作原理,为实际应用提供有益的参考,随着技术的不断发展,分布式文件系统将在未来发挥更加重要的作用。

标签: #分布式文件系统的基本架构

黑狐家游戏
  • 评论列表

留言评论